MoneyLion: Partners NFL player to tackle financial literacy gap

  • MoneyLion digital financial solution gives people access to a comprehensive suite of products 
  • Announced it launched MLU as part of a groundbreaking, innovative financial literacy initiative
  • Partnered with NFL player and University of Pennsylvania (“UPenn”) Lecturer, Brandon Copeland
  • Bring a compelling curriculum centered around real-world money education and skills to consumers nationwide
  • According to FINRA Investor Education Foundation’s National Financial Capability Study, financial education matters
  • MLU will fill in the current education gaps, bringing premium “edutainment” to customers
